Capacity note for the Quillmere public API, ahead of the 4.2 release. Cursor-based pagination on the /listings endpoints is now the default, and the old offset mode will be removed next quarter. Load tests from the Hollowbrook cluster show that page sizes above 200 push p95 latency past our budget once concurrent readers exceed roughly 1,500. We recommend the release manager lock the values below into the gateway config before the freeze. The constants we validated are as follows.

tuning table, kahop-fahog:
RATE_LIMITS = {
    "wenix": 1,
    "druael": 10,
    "holix": 1,
    "zorael": 1,
}

## Deploying the Gatewick Proctor Queue

Deploys are pretty painless: push to main, wait for the pipeline, then watch the queue drain dashboard for five minutes. If candidates pile up mid-exam, roll back first and ask questions later — the queue replays safely. Everything the workers care about lives in one config block, shown here for reference.

settings of bafof-yagef:
JOROX_PIN=8740
JOROX_TENANT=pelox
JOROX_METRICS_HOST=metrics.jorox.qorvelworks.internal
JOROX_SEAL=seal_c78f63c1
JOROX_STANDBY_TEAM=norax

Sale of the Marrowgate Unit (Managers Only)

For sales leads: Fennick & Vale has agreed terms to sell the Marrowgate distribution unit. Until completion, continue quoting and fulfilling Marrowgate orders as normal; do not discuss the sale with customers. Commission structures are unaffected this quarter, and account reassignments will be communicated centrally after close. The confidential note on business plans is set out below.

board note of yagaf-yawig: Project Gorvan slips by one quarter because of the staffing delay.